Industry Leader Shares Insights on Autonomous Vehicle Technology
In a recent interview, Xinzhou Wu, a prominent figure in the Chinese automotive industry, shared his thoughts on the current state of autonomous vehicle technology. Wu’s comments shed light on the company’s approach to self-driving cars, the role of lidar in the development process, and the potential future of the industry as a whole.
Autonomy and the Need for Lidar
Lidar (Light Detection and Ranging) technology has been a topic of discussion in the autonomous vehicle space for some time now. The technology uses laser light to create high-resolution 3D maps of the environment, which can be used to build accurate models of the surrounding area. Many companies, including some of the biggest players in the industry, rely heavily on lidar in their development of autonomous vehicles.
However, Wu’s comments suggest that Xinzhou may be taking a more nuanced approach to lidar. In the interview, he mentioned that while lidar can be a useful tool in certain situations, it is not always necessary for the development of autonomous vehicles. This could indicate a shift away from the traditional reliance on lidar that has characterized the industry up to this point.
